Comprehending Asbestos and Its Dangers



Asbestos, a naturally happening mineral recognized for its heat resistance and durability, poses severe wellness threats when its fibers are inhaled or ingested. asbestos air testing. Exposure to asbestos can lead to severe health and wellness problems such as lung cancer cells, mesothelioma cancer, and asbestosis. Regardless of its valuable residential properties, asbestos has been extensively prohibited in many countries as a result of the proven link between asbestos exposure and these deadly conditions


The risk hinges on the microscopic fibers that can easily come to be air-borne when asbestos-containing products are disrupted or damaged. As soon as breathed in, these fibers can end up being lodged in the lungs, triggering inflammation and scarring over time. The latency period between direct exposure to asbestos and the growth of related diseases can cover several years, making very early discovery and prevention vital.


Asbestos was frequently made use of in building materials, insulation, and automotive parts prior to its wellness risks were totally recognized. Today, appropriate testing and elimination of asbestos-containing materials are important to secure people from the threats linked with asbestos direct exposure.

One usual technique for determining prospective asbestos materials is with aesthetic inspection. This involves seeking details attributes such as a coarse look, a grayish shade, or specific labeling suggesting the presence of asbestos. Aesthetic assessment alone is not sufficient for conclusive identification, as asbestos fibers are often tiny and might not be noticeable to the naked eye.


In instances where aesthetic examination is undetermined, samples of believed products can be accumulated and sent out to certified labs for screening. These research laboratories utilize specialized methods such as polarized light microscopy or transmission electron microscopy to accurately browse around this web-site figure out the visibility of asbestos fibers in the examples. Carrying Out Example Collection Safely



When gathering samples for asbestos testing, focusing on precaution is paramount to decrease possible exposure threats. Asbestos fibers are hazardous when interrupted, making it critical to adhere to proper safety methods during sample collection - testing asbestos near me. Before starting the sampling process, guarantee that you are furnished with personal protective equipment (PPE) such as non reusable coveralls, goggles, masks, and gloves to avoid breathing or contact with asbestos fibers


It is necessary to wet the sampling area utilizing a gentle haze of water to protect against the fibers from coming to be air-borne during collection. Use care when collecting examples and stay clear of aggressive scraping or piercing that could release asbestos fibers into the air. Instead, carefully cut a little item of the material utilizing ideal tools and put it into a secured container for evaluation by a qualified lab.


Moreover, classifying each sample with comprehensive information pertaining to the sampling day, location, and enthusiast's name is vital for accurate record-keeping and evaluation. By following these security standards, you can carry out sample collection for asbestos screening successfully while reducing the threat of direct exposure.

Upon getting the asbestos screening results, it is important to evaluate the findings accurately and without delay determine the required actions to address any kind of determined threats. The examination outcomes will certainly suggest the visibility or lack of asbestos, the sort of asbestos fibers existing, and the concentration levels. It is crucial to assess the degree of contamination and review the potential risks to occupants or workers if asbestos is found. Based on the results, instant steps need to be required to reduce exposure and avoid any more spread of asbestos fibers. This may include securing off influenced locations, implementing correct ventilation systems, or even emptying if the scenario is extreme. It is a good idea to speak with asbestos remediation professionals visit this web-site to create an extensive strategy for secure removal and disposal of asbestos-containing materials. In addition, routine tracking and retesting should be set up to make certain that the removal efforts achieved success which the environment is secure for occupancy or work activities.
